What Is the Lemon Law in Georgia?
Georgia’s Lemon Law is designed to protect consumers who purchase or lease new vehicles that turn out to be defective. These defects often affect safety, performance, or value and remain unresolved even after repeated repair attempts.
The law typically applies if:
- Your vehicle has a serious defect that cannot be fixed after a reasonable number of attempts.
- The car spends an extended amount of time (usually 30 days or more) in the repair shop.
- The defect appeared within the first 24 months or 24,000 miles of ownership (whichever comes first).

Remedies Available Under the Lemon Law
If your case qualifies, you may be entitled to one of the following remedies:
- Vehicle Replacement – A new car of the same or comparable model.
- Refund – A refund of the purchase price, minus a reasonable allowance for use.
- Cash Compensation – Monetary damages for costs and inconveniences.

Steps to Take if You Suspect You Have a Lemon
If you believe your car may qualify as a lemon, take these steps:
- Keep Records – Save all repair invoices, receipts, and communications with the dealership.
- Report Defects Promptly – Notify the dealer or manufacturer about issues as soon as they occur.
- Follow the Repair Process – Give the manufacturer a fair chance to repair the vehicle.
